Access Denied

You don't have permission to access "http://www.iciparisxl.be/Base/PHOTO-FILTER-br-FOND-DE-TEINT-POUDRE-puwwAKgC8MT_cAAAFXg0QobiBx-BE-WFS-fr_BE-EUR.html;pgid=SLdyiwpDUg1SR0irgaGpeFZY00006tBBDdnt;sid=MVb_dIGVJ0P7dNmGohb1WwGfb77G4t99CMA=" on this server.

Reference #18.1ce1dd17.1711687695.85296bb

https://errors.edgesuite.net/18.1ce1dd17.1711687695.85296bb